Is Bullriding for you?

There are several organizations for kids who are interested in bull riding. The National Little Britches Rodeo is perhaps the premier youth rodeo organization. There are hundreds of youth rodeos sponsored by them across the country. Many kids get their first taste of rodeo through this organization. The National High School Rodeo Organization offers older kids a chance to grow as rodeo athletes. This has become a wide spread circuit helping students develop their skills. There is also a division that focuses on junior high aged students. Many bull riders have been a part of these organizations. Compared to other sports, these circuits and leagues offer a similar line of training as one works their way up the competition ladder.

What if you are older and are looking to make it as a bull rider? A bull rider must be in great shape. Their body will be put through extreme conditions. In order to stand up to the wear and tear, the rider must be in excellent physical condition. There are many bull riding schools across the country and in Canada. These offer older riders a chance to learn from the best. You will learn how to ride properly and will be provided with extensive training. It is essential to have expert training and guidance if you want to make it in this tough sport. Another way to get involved is to go to as many bull riding events as possible.

At an event, take a close look at what the bull riders are doing throughout the event. Talk to whoever you can who is connected with the sport. Bull riders are famous for the approachability. See if they would be willing to talk to you about how they made it to the competition level. If you are willing to talk to those involved, it may open doors for your future riding career!
